Response to GnRH on day 6 of the estrous cycle is diminished as the percentage of Bos indicus breeding increases in Angus, Brangus, and BrahmanxAngus heifers

摘要

Angus (n=6), Brangus (5/8 Angusx3/8 Brahman, n=6), and BrahmanxAngus (3/8 Angusx5/8 Brahman, n=6) heifers exhibiting estrous cycles at regular intervals were used to determine if the percentage of Bos indicus breeding influenced the secretory patterns of LH in response to a GnRH treatment on Day 6 of the estrous cycle. Heifers were pre-synchronized with a two-injection PGF(2alpha) protocol (25mg i.m. Day -14 and 12.5mg i.m. Day -3 and -2 of experiment). Heifers received 100mug GnRH i.m. on Day 6 of the subsequent estrous cycle. Blood samples were collected at -60, -30, and -1min before GnRH and 15, 30, 60, 90, 120, 150, 180, 240, 300, 360, 420, and 480min after GnRH to determine concentrations of serum LH. Estradiol concentrations were determined at -60, -30, and -1min before GnRH. On Day 6 and 8, ovaries were examined by ultrasonography to determine if ovulation occurred. On Day 13, heifers received 25mg PGF(2alpha) i.m. and blood samples were collected daily until either the expression of estrus or Day 20 for heifers not exhibiting estrus to determine progesterone concentrations. There was no effect (P>0.10) of breed on ovulation rate to GnRH as well as size of the largest follicle, mean estradiol, and mean corpus luteum volume at GnRH. Mean LH was greater (P<0.05) for Angus (7.0+/-0.8ng/mL) compared to Brangus (4.6+/-0.8ng/mL) and BrahmanxAngus (2.9+/-0.8ng/mL), which were similar (P>0.10). Mean LH peak-height was similar (P>0.10) for Brangus (13.9+/-3.4ng/mL) compared to Angus (21.9+/-3.4ng/mL) and BrahmanxAngus (8.0+/-3.4ng/mL), but was greater (P<0.05) for Angus compared to BrahmanxAngus. Interval from GnRH to LH peak was similar (P>0.10) between breeds. As the percentage of Bos indicus breeding increased the amount of LH released in response to GnRH on Day 6 of the estrous cycle decreased.
